What Do Swelling And Numbness In The Lips Indicate?

HI, My lips are swollen and numb. I think I am allergic to something I came in contact with over the weekend. Swollen lips are my only symptom. I have been taking Benadryl. Should I see my DR or is it possible to treat myself without seeing a doctor? Is there an easy way to determine what caused my reaction?

It seems that the symptoms of swelling of lips and numb feeling can be due to Allergic reaction causing Allergic Angioedema of lips.
It can be due to any food or medication while other causes can be allergic reaction to any skin cosmetic, soap, lip balm etc.
No you should not treat it at home as if even after taking anti allergic like Benadryl also the swelling is not reducing.
I would suggest you to consult a Physician and get evaluated and a clinical evaluation and investigations like blood tests for allergies like RAST TEST, Patch test, Food Challenge test can help in ruling out the exact cause of the symptoms and treat accordingly.
As of now take anti allergic like Levocetrizine or Allegra.
Do cool compresses over the lips .
You can be advised injectable steroids and antihistamines to reduce swelling.
